What is a 15 X 12 Undermount Bathroom Sink?
A 15 X 12 undermount bathroom sink is a sink that is installed underneath the countertop. It’s a popular choice for those who want a clean and streamlined look in their bathroom. The dimensions of this sink make it perfect for smaller bathrooms or powder rooms.

Pros and Cons of 15 X 12 Undermount Bathroom Sink
Like any product, there are pros and cons to the 15 X 12 undermount bathroom sink. Here are a few:
Pros:
- Sleek and modern look
- Perfect for small bathrooms or powder rooms
- Easy to clean
- Comes in a variety of materials and colors
Cons:
- May not be deep enough for some people
- Installation can be tricky
- May require a professional plumber

Question & Answer and FAQs
Q: Can I install a 15 X 12 undermount bathroom sink myself?
A: If you have experience with plumbing and feel confident in your skills, you may be able to install it yourself. Otherwise, it’s best to hire a professional plumber.
Q: What materials are available for 15 X 12 undermount bathroom sinks?
A: The most common materials are porcelain, ceramic, and stainless steel. However, there are other materials available as well.
Q: What is the average cost of a 15 X 12 undermount bathroom sink?
A: The cost can vary depending on the material, brand, and where you purchase it. On average, you can expect to spend between $50 and $200.
